What is the B1 Level?
The CEFR specifies the [B1 Zertifikat](http://www.kaseisyoji.com/home.php?mod=space&uid=3894902) level as the capability to comprehend the primary points of clear standard input on familiar matters regularly encountered in work, school, and leisure. At this phase, a student can handle a lot of situations likely to develop while traveling in a location where the language is spoken. Additionally, a B1 speaker can produce basic linked text on topics that are familiar or of personal interest and can describe experiences, events, dreams, hopes, and ambitions.

1. Reading (Lesen)
In this area, candidates need to demonstrate their capability to comprehend different types of texts, such as blog site posts, news article, ads, and official directions. It evaluates the capability to recognize both the essence and particular information.
2. Listening (Hören)
The listening module involves numerous audio clips, consisting of statements, brief discussions, radio features, and informal discussions. Prospects must address questions that prove they can follow the circulation of information in basic German.
3. Writing (Schreiben)
The composing area generally consists of 3 tasks:

The speaking examination is generally performed in sets. It includes:

There are three primary suppliers of the B1 German Certificate. While the levels are standardized, the format and administrative guidelines differ slightly.
Goethe-Zertifikat B1: Known for its modular system. A prospect can take and pass modules separately. Essential Grammar and Vocabulary for B1
To succeed at the B1 level, students need to move beyond simple subject-verb-object sentences. The following lists highlight the essential linguistic requirements for this level.

Q: How long does it require to reach [Sprachzertifikat B1 Deutsch](https://doc.adminforge.de/s/EguIeYmyTP) level?A: According to the Goethe-Institut, it usually takes in between 350 and 650 teaching systems (45-minute lessons) to reach B1, depending on previous knowledge and learning strength.

Q: How long is the B1 certificate legitimate?A: Officially, the certificates do not expire. Nevertheless, many employers or authorities (such as the Foreigners' Office) may need a certificate that disappears than two years old to ensure your abilities are still existing.

Q: Can I retake the exam if I stop working?A: Yes. If you take the Goethe-Zertifikat, you can retake specific modules. If you take the [Telc B1 Zertifikat](https://output.jsbin.com/tezizakicu/) test, you might need to retake the whole oral or written part depending upon the specific score.

Q: Is B1 enough to study at a German university?A: Generally, no. The majority of undergraduate programs need a C1 level (DSH or TestDaF). However, B1 is typically the entry requirement for a Studienkolleg (preparatory college).

Q: Can I take the B1 examination online?A: While some practice materials are online, the main B1 certificate tests should be taken at a licensed screening center under supervised conditions.
